This is a thoughtful book on toxic masculinity and complicated psychological motivations. Adam is a 90s teen who is hot shit in a small pond. His parents are both therapists at a local hospital, and his mother is a famous pop psychology author.

Between the three narrators and frequent time shifts, this is a book that demands all your attention, but the poetic prose balanced by unrelenting testosterone make this worth reading. 4.5⭐️ 🔽🔽
